<?php
/**
* This file is part of the Nette Framework (https://nette.org)
* Copyright (c) 2004 David Grudl (https://davidgrudl.com)
*/
declare(strict_types=1);
namespace Nette\Utils;
use Nette;
/**
* PHP reflection helpers.
*/
final class Reflection
{
use Nette\StaticClass;
/** @deprecated use Nette\Utils\Validator::isBuiltinType() */
public static function isBuiltinType(string $type): bool
{
return Validators::isBuiltinType($type);
}
/** @deprecated use Nette\Utils\Validator::isClassKeyword() */
public static function isClassKeyword(string $name): bool
{
return Validators::isClassKeyword($name);
}
/** @deprecated use native ReflectionParameter::getDefaultValue() */
public static function getParameterDefaultValue(\ReflectionParameter $param): mixed
{
if ($param->isDefaultValueConstant()) {
$const = $orig = $param->getDefaultValueConstantName();
$pair = explode('::', $const);
if (isset($pair[1])) {
$pair[0] = Type::resolve($pair[0], $param);
try {
$rcc = new \ReflectionClassConstant($pair[0], $pair[1]);
} catch (\ReflectionException $e) {
$name = self::toString($param);
throw new \ReflectionException("Unable to resolve constant $orig used as default value of $name.", 0, $e);
}
return $rcc->getValue();
} elseif (!defined($const)) {
$const = substr((string) strrchr($const, '\\'), 1);
if (!defined($const)) {
$name = self::toString($param);
throw new \ReflectionException("Unable to resolve constant $orig used as default value of $name.");
}
}
return constant($const);
}
return $param->getDefaultValue();
}
/**
* Returns a reflection of a class or trait that contains a declaration of given property. Property can also be declared in the trait.
*/
public static function getPropertyDeclaringClass(\ReflectionProperty $prop): \ReflectionClass
{
foreach ($prop->getDeclaringClass()->getTraits() as $trait) {
if ($trait->hasProperty($prop->name)
// doc-comment guessing as workaround for insufficient PHP reflection
&& $trait->getProperty($prop->name)->getDocComment() === $prop->getDocComment()
) {
return self::getPropertyDeclaringClass($trait->getProperty($prop->name));
}
}
return $prop->getDeclaringClass();
}
/**
* Returns a reflection of a method that contains a declaration of $method.
* Usually, each method is its own declaration, but the body of the method can also be in the trait and under a different name.
*/
public static function getMethodDeclaringMethod(\ReflectionMethod $method): \ReflectionMethod
{
// file & line guessing as workaround for insufficient PHP reflection
$decl = $method->getDeclaringClass();
if ($decl->getFileName() === $method->getFileName()
&& $decl->getStartLine() <= $method->getStartLine()
&& $decl->getEndLine() >= $method->getEndLine()
) {
return $method;
}
$hash = [$method->getFileName(), $method->getStartLine(), $method->getEndLine()];
if (($alias = $decl->getTraitAliases()[$method->name] ?? null)
&& ($m = new \ReflectionMethod($alias))
&& $hash === [$m->getFileName(), $m->getStartLine(), $m->getEndLine()]
) {
return self::getMethodDeclaringMethod($m);
}
foreach ($decl->getTraits() as $trait) {
if ($trait->hasMethod($method->name)
&& ($m = $trait->getMethod($method->name))
&& $hash === [$m->getFileName(), $m->getStartLine(), $m->getEndLine()]
) {
return self::getMethodDeclaringMethod($m);
}
}
return $method;
}
/**
* Finds out if reflection has access to PHPdoc comments. Comments may not be available due to the opcode cache.
*/
public static function areCommentsAvailable(): bool
{
static $res;
return $res ?? $res = (bool) (new \ReflectionMethod(__METHOD__))->getDocComment();
}
public static function toString(\Reflector $ref): string
{
if ($ref instanceof \ReflectionClass) {
return $ref->name;
} elseif ($ref instanceof \ReflectionMethod) {
return $ref->getDeclaringClass()->name . '::' . $ref->name . '()';
} elseif ($ref instanceof \ReflectionFunction) {
return $ref->name . '()';
} elseif ($ref instanceof \ReflectionProperty) {
return self::getPropertyDeclaringClass($ref)->name . '::$' . $ref->name;
} elseif ($ref instanceof \ReflectionParameter) {
return '$' . $ref->name . ' in ' . self::toString($ref->getDeclaringFunction());
} else {
throw new Nette\InvalidArgumentException;
}
}
/**
* Expands the name of the class to full name in the given context of given class.
* Thus, it returns how the PHP parser would understand $name if it were written in the body of the class $context.
* @throws Nette\InvalidArgumentException
*/
public static function expandClassName(string $name, \ReflectionClass $context): string
{
$lower = strtolower($name);
if (empty($name)) {
throw new Nette\InvalidArgumentException('Class name must not be empty.');
} elseif (Validators::isBuiltinType($lower)) {
return $lower;
} elseif ($lower === 'self' || $lower === 'static') {
return $context->name;
} elseif ($lower === 'parent') {
return $context->getParentClass()
? $context->getParentClass()->name
: 'parent';
} elseif ($name[0] === '\\') { // fully qualified name
return ltrim($name, '\\');
}
$uses = self::getUseStatements($context);
$parts = explode('\\', $name, 2);
if (isset($uses[$parts[0]])) {
$parts[0] = $uses[$parts[0]];
return implode('\\', $parts);
} elseif ($context->inNamespace()) {
return $context->getNamespaceName() . '\\' . $name;
} else {
return $name;
}
}
/** @return array<string, class-string> of [alias => class] */
public static function getUseStatements(\ReflectionClass $class): array
{
if ($class->isAnonymous()) {
throw new Nette\NotImplementedException('Anonymous classes are not supported.');
}
static $cache = [];
if (!isset($cache[$name = $class->name])) {
if ($class->isInternal()) {
$cache[$name] = [];
} else {
$code = file_get_contents($class->getFileName());
$cache = self::parseUseStatements($code, $name) + $cache;
}
}
return $cache[$name];
}
/**
* Parses PHP code to [class => [alias => class, ...]]
*/
private static function parseUseStatements(string $code, ?string $forClass = null): array
{
try {
$tokens = \PhpToken::tokenize($code, TOKEN_PARSE);
} catch (\ParseError $e) {
trigger_error($e->getMessage(), E_USER_NOTICE);
$tokens = [];
}
$namespace = $class = null;
$classLevel = $level = 0;
$res = $uses = [];
$nameTokens = [T_STRING, T_NS_SEPARATOR, T_NAME_QUALIFIED, T_NAME_FULLY_QUALIFIED];
while ($token = current($tokens)) {
next($tokens);
switch ($token->id) {
case T_NAMESPACE:
$namespace = ltrim(self::fetch($tokens, $nameTokens) . '\\', '\\');
$uses = [];
break;
case T_CLASS:
case T_INTERFACE:
case T_TRAIT:
case PHP_VERSION_ID < 80100
? T_CLASS
: T_ENUM:
if ($name = self::fetch($tokens, T_STRING)) {
$class = $namespace . $name;
$classLevel = $level + 1;
$res[$class] = $uses;
if ($class === $forClass) {
return $res;
}
}
break;
case T_USE:
while (!$class && ($name = self::fetch($tokens, $nameTokens))) {
$name = ltrim($name, '\\');
if (self::fetch($tokens, '{')) {
while ($suffix = self::fetch($tokens, $nameTokens)) {
if (self::fetch($tokens, T_AS)) {
$uses[self::fetch($tokens, T_STRING)] = $name . $suffix;
} else {
$tmp = explode('\\', $suffix);
$uses[end($tmp)] = $name . $suffix;
}
if (!self::fetch($tokens, ',')) {
break;
}
}
} elseif (self::fetch($tokens, T_AS)) {
$uses[self::fetch($tokens, T_STRING)] = $name;
} else {
$tmp = explode('\\', $name);
$uses[end($tmp)] = $name;
}
if (!self::fetch($tokens, ',')) {
break;
}
}
break;
case T_CURLY_OPEN:
case T_DOLLAR_OPEN_CURLY_BRACES:
case ord('{'):
$level++;
break;
case ord('}'):
if ($level === $classLevel) {
$class = $classLevel = 0;
}
$level--;
}
}
return $res;
}
private static function fetch(array &$tokens, string|int|array $take): ?string
{
$res = null;
while ($token = current($tokens)) {
if ($token->is($take)) {
$res .= $token->text;
} elseif (!$token->is([T_DOC_COMMENT, T_WHITESPACE, T_COMMENT])) {
break;
}
next($tokens);
}
return $res;
}
}
